  • PC user can't open compresses PDF from MAC (Stuffit)

    Our PC clients get an error message that the PDF is not a valid photoshop document.  I use OSX 10.6.8 with stuffit 15.0.4 to compress the large date files. Any ideas on a fix?

    Stuffit is the only app I know of which can decompress its own format. Your Windows clients must use the free Expander to open them. Otherwise, use OS X's built in zip compression and they'll be able to open the files without the need of third party software. Right click on any item, or group of items and choose, "Compress xxx Items" (how it will read if more than one item is chosen).

  • How can i open a PDF bank statement in numbers so that the rows and columns contain properly aligned data from statement?

    how can i open a PDF bank statement in "numbers" so that the rows and columns contain properly aligned data from statement?

    Numbers can store pdfs pages or clippings but does not directly open pdf files.  To get the bank statement into Numbers as a table I would open the bank statment in Preview (or Skim) or some pdf viewer.
    Then hold the option key while selecting a column of data.
    Then copy
    Then switch to numbers and paste the column into a table
    Then repeat for the other columns in the pdf document
    It would be easier (in my opinion) to download the QFX or CSV version from your bank

  • Just upgraded to Lion, can't open any pdf file downloaded from internet that was fine with Leopard. How can I overcome this obstacle ?

    Just upgraded to Lion, can't open any pdf file downloaded from the internet that was fine with Leopard before. I just got a black screen when I clicked on a pdf icon on a given internet site, and same happened with several sites that I visited. How can I overcome this obstacle ?

    Try two things with Safari not running:
    1) Launch Adobe Reader, open its preferences, select the Internet category, and check the values under "Display PDF in browser using".  If it's checked, try unchecking it.
    2) Look in /Library/Internet Plug-Ins (at the top-level of your boot volume) for something names AdobePDFViewer.plugin.  If you see such a file, try moving it to a folder named "Disabled Plug-Ins" (if such a folder exists) or onto the Desktop.
    Then see how things work.

  • I can download and open pdfs on my macbook air.  Why can't I open a pdf from a webpage?

    I can download and open pdfs on my macbook air.  Why can't I open a pdf from a webpage?

    Back up all data.
    Triple-click the line of text below to select it, the copy the selected text to the Clipboard (command-C):
    /Library/Internet Plug-ins
    In the Finder, select
    Go > Go to Folder
    from the menu bar, or press the key combination shift-command-G. Paste into the text box that opens (command-V), then press return.
    From the folder that opens, remove any items that have the letters “PDF” in the name. You may be prompted for your login password. Then quit and relaunch Safari, and test.
    The "Silverlight" web plugin distributed by Microsoft can also interfere with PDF display in Safari, so you may need to remove it as well, if it's present.
    If you still have the issue, repeat with this line:
    ~/Library/Internet Plug-ins
    If you don’t like the results of this procedure, restore the items from the backup you made before you started. Relaunch Safari again.

  • I can open a pdf from email on a laptop, not on the desktop. The desktop tells me invalid file format. I have went through the list from support.

    Had a virus on the desktop, then had a reformat, now I can not open adobe pdf in firefox from yahoo email. I have reinstalled Acrobat reader, same problem.I can open it in internet explorer. I can open it on the laptop.

    Hi Gary,
    I have seen this issue occur with users who have this registry setting missing or have improper permissions.
    When you double click the attachment to launch the pdf it is saved and opened from the temporary folder unless saved specifically to a location.
    If you dont have the below mentioned registry key or improper permissions then attachments fail to open.
    Please  heck if the following reg key exists:
    HKEY_CURRENT_USER\Software\Microsoft\Office\14.0\Outlook\Security
    or
    HKEY_CURRENT_USER\Software\Policies\Microsoft\Office\14.0\Outlook\Security
    Value Name: OutlookSecureTempFolder
    If the value exists, and if the value contains a valid path, Outlook 2010 uses that location for its temporary files.
    If the registry value does not exist, or if the value points to an invalid location, Outlook 2010, Outlook 2007, or Outlook 2003 creates a new subdirectory under the Temporary Internet Files directory and then puts the temporary file in the new subdirectory. The name of the new subdirectory is unknown and is randomly generated, depending on your version of Outlook.
    Please check the following key:
    HKEY_CURRENT_USER\Software\Microsoft\Office\14.0\Outlook\Security
    Note the location for: OutlookSecureTempFolder key
    Check if the same folder exists in the following location and if not create a corresponding folder in the location on C:\Users\<User account name>\Appdata\Local\Software\Microsoft\Windows\......
